The Most Uncomfortable Questions People Have Ever Been Asked

Reddit user Dr_Cloying asked: 'What's the most uncomfortable question you've ever been asked?'

Everyone jokes about not liking small talk and how ridiculous it is to talk about the weather, sports, and the traffic all the time.

But compared to the most uncomfortable questions someone might ask, those dull topics might be the way to go.


Redditor Dr_Cloying asked:

"What's the most uncomfortable question you've ever been asked?"

Child Loss

"At the start of the pandemic, my hospital asked all pregnant staff to go home and shield. I was very early in the pregnancy and had had two previous miscarriages that no one at work knew about."

"Everyone found out why I was shielding, because what other reason did a doctor have to not work during the pandemic?"

"I ultimately had another miscarriage and came back a few months later."

"A male colleague I was friendly with said, 'It's so good to see you back, what did you have?' (Assuming I had the baby.)"

"I said, 'A miscarriage.'"

"(He literally stopped in his tracks, apologized a ton, and was extra gentle around me for a few weeks. I've got an amazing two-year-old now and am due with my second any day. )"

- DrBasia

Dating Scene

"On the third night that my wife was in the hospital for blood clots, a nurse asked me, 'If she passes away, how long before you start dating again?'"

"WHAT?!"

"I told her that, 'Should she die, YOU are the first person I'll have investigated.'"

"I never saw that RN again the rest of my wife's stay in the hospital."

- GeneOTheGreen
